Step by Step

Check circle icon

Step 1

Heat the vegetable oil in a large pot over medium-high heat. Add the onion, ginger, garlic, salt, and pepper and cook for about 3 minutes, until the onions begin to soften and become aromatic.
Check circle icon

Step 2

Add the brown sugar, turmeric, and curry paste and stir to coat the aromatics. Cook until the mixture is fragrant and begins to simmer, about 5 minutes.
Check circle icon

Step 3

Add the potatoes and coconut milk. Stir to combine and bring to a boil. Once boiling, cover, reduce the heat to low and simmer until the potatoes are tender, about 20 minutes. Remove from the heat.
Check circle icon

Step 4

Ladle the soup into bowls and garnish with whatever vegetables and herbs you have on hand.
